1. Optimize Your LinkedIn Profile: Your Digital Shop Window
Think of your LinkedIn profile as your professional shop window. Every element needs to be curated to attract the right kind of attention. This is your first step towards establishing a strong foundation for online earning in India.
- High-Quality Profile Picture: This is non-negotiable. Use a clear, professional headshot where you're smiling and looking approachable. Avoid selfies or group photos. A good profile picture makes you 14 times more likely to be viewed.
- Compelling Headline: Don't just list your job title. Use this space (120 characters) to describe what you do, who you help, and what value you offer.
- Example: Instead of "Marketing Executive at XYZ Corp", try "Digital Marketing Strategist | Helping SMEs Boost Online Sales by 30%+ | SEO, Social Media & Content Expert". This instantly tells recruiters and clients what you're capable of.
- Impactful "About" Section (Summary): This is your chance to tell your story. Write a concise yet engaging narrative (around 3-5 paragraphs) that highlights your passions, skills, achievements, and career goals. Use keywords relevant to your industry.
- Pro Tip: Start with a hook, explain your expertise, mention key achievements (e.g., "Grew Instagram following by 50% for a client in Mumbai"), and end with a call to action (e.g., "Open to collaborations in digital marketing" or "Let's connect to discuss online earning strategies").
- Detailed Experience Section: Go beyond listing job responsibilities. Use bullet points to highlight achievements, quantifiable results, and the impact you made.
- Example: Instead of "Managed social media accounts", write "Increased organic reach by 40% and generated ₹50,000 in leads through targeted social media campaigns for a local e-commerce brand."
- Showcase Your Education & Certifications: Include all relevant degrees, diplomas, and certifications. 2. Build Thought Leadership Through Content Creation
Your LinkedIn profile isn't just a static resume; it's a dynamic platform to share your expertise and establish yourself as a thought leader. This is crucial for attracting opportunities for work from home and building a strong personal brand.
- Share Relevant Industry News: Curate and share articles, news, and insights relevant to your niche. Add your perspective or a question to spark discussion.
- Create Original Posts: Share short updates, quick tips, or personal insights related to your field. These could be reflections on industry trends, advice for aspiring professionals, or even short success stories.
- Write LinkedIn Articles: For more in-depth content, use LinkedIn's article publishing feature. This is ideal for explaining complex topics, sharing case studies, or offering comprehensive guides.
- Ideas: "5 Essential Digital Marketing Tools for Indian Startups", "A Beginner's Guide to Affiliate Marketing in India", "How I Generated Passive Income with a Side Hustle".
- Engage with Multimedia: Use images, videos, and PDFs to make your content more engaging. A short video explaining a concept or a visually appealing infographic can capture attention more effectively.
- Post Consistently: Regular posting (2-3 times a week) keeps you visible and reinforces your expertise. Consistency is key to building an audience and showing that you are actively involved in your field.

3. Network Strategically: Connections That Count
LinkedIn is, at its core, a networking platform. Building meaningful connections is vital for career advancement, finding mentors, and discovering avenues to earn money online.
- Connect with Purpose: Don't just send connection requests blindly. Personalize your invitation messages, explaining why you want to connect (e.g., "I enjoyed your recent post on SEO trends, and I'd love to connect and learn more from your insights").
- Engage with Your Network: It's not enough to connect; you need to engage.
- Comment Thoughtfully: Instead of a generic "Great post!", offer genuine insights, ask follow-up questions, or share your own relevant experiences. This positions you as an engaged professional.
- Congratulate & Acknowledge: Wish connections on work anniversaries, new jobs, or shared achievements. These small gestures build goodwill.
- Join Relevant Groups: Participate in LinkedIn groups related to your industry, skills (e.g., "Indian Digital Marketers Forum"), or interests. Contribute to discussions, answer questions, and share your expertise. This is an excellent way to expand your network and discover niche opportunities for online earning.
- Follow Influencers & Companies: Stay updated on industry trends and company news by following key figures and organizations in your field. This also provides content ideas for your own posts.
4. Showcase Your Skills & Endorsements: Your Credibility Score
Your skills and the validation from your network significantly boost your credibility, making you more attractive for roles and projects that allow you to earn money online in India.
- Populate Your Skills Section: Add all relevant skills, from technical expertise (e.g., "SEO," "Content Writing," "Google Analytics," "Web Development") to soft skills (e.g., "Communication," "Leadership," "Problem-Solving"). LinkedIn allows up to 50 skills.
- Seek Endorsements: Ask colleagues, managers, or clients to endorse your skills. The more endorsements you have for a particular skill, the more credible you appear.
- Request Recommendations: Recommendations are powerful testimonials. Reach out to former managers, professors, or clients and ask them to write a recommendation highlighting your strengths and contributions. These provide social proof and significantly enhance your personal brand.
- Example: A recommendation from a client praising your digital marketing services can be a game-changer for attracting new freelance projects.
- Add Your Portfolio/Projects: Use the "Featured" section or "Projects" section to showcase your best work, case studies, or portfolio items. This is especially important for creatives, marketers, and developers looking for work from home gigs or side income projects.

6. Consistency, Analytics, and Adaptability
Building a powerful personal brand on LinkedIn is an ongoing process that requires dedication and smart adjustments.
- Be Consistent: Regularly update your profile, post new content, and engage with your network. An inactive profile quickly loses its impact.
- Monitor Your Analytics: LinkedIn provides basic analytics on who's viewing your profile and your post performance. Use this data to understand what resonates with your audience and adjust your strategy accordingly.
- Stay Updated: The digital landscape evolves rapidly. Keep your skills current, update your profile with new achievements, and adapt your content strategy to reflect new trends.
